Parityscope compares hotel rates across partner feeds every fifteen minutes. Each crawl worker holds a session that expires after thirty minutes of inactivity; expired sessions cause silent gaps in the parity report, not errors, so watch the freshness dashboard carefully. If sessions churn rapidly, restart the Bellhaven coordinator before escalating. When manually resuming a stalled crawl, you must authenticate the session-restore call with the bearer token that appears directly below this paragraph.

login token, bajeg-kahap: eyJhbGciOiJIUzI1NiIsInR5cCI6IkpXVCJ9.eyJzdWIiOiIv9ZqjrIn0._l4tCo-8

Subject: On-call handover — Userland extraction

Hi Dario,

Handing over the Userland workstream: we're mid-flight splitting the user module out of the Corvid monolith. Auth routes now proxy to the new service; profile writes still hit the monolith. Do not toggle the dual-write flag without checking replication lag on the shadow table first. Runbook is in the Meridian wiki under "Userland Cutover." Open items are tracked in the extraction board. Questions after my rotation ends should go to the platform lead at the address below.

escalation mailbox, bafog-fafog: ulador@paliqlabs.internal

Compression on Wireknot websocket frames trades CPU for egress. permessage-deflate with context takeover saved 38% bandwidth but doubled p99 frame latency under load. We disable takeover and compress only frames above a size floor. Future maintainers: benchmark before changing anything here. The chosen settings are below.

tuning table, kahop-fahog:
RATE_LIMITS = {
    "wenix": 1,
    "druael": 10,
    "holix": 1,
    "zorael": 1,
}

## Changelog — SnapKestrel 2.8

Defaults for UI component snapshot testing have changed. Snapshots now serialize with stable prop ordering, obsolete snapshots are pruned automatically on CI runs, and the diff threshold for image snapshots is stricter. New team members: you do not need to update local tooling; the runner picks these up automatically. If a snapshot fails unexpectedly, regenerate before debugging. The effective default configuration shipped with this release is listed below.

service settings:
PRAIX_LOG_LEVEL=error
PRAIX_METRICS_HOST=metrics.praix.qorvelcorp.corp
PRAIX_POOL_SIZE=16